The match between the young Buccaneers and the KwaZulu-Natal side will open the sixth game week of the current Reserve League season.
Form Guide
The Soweto Giants have had a less-than-stellar start to the season, as they are currently in the middle of the table following a home loss to AmaZulu in their most recent match, which was decided by a single goal.
The loss was their second of the season, in which they have also recorded two victories and one tie.
Following a winning start to the season, this has placed them in seventh place in the standings, a considerable distance below where they would have liked to be at this point.
On Saturday, they will have everything to play for, as they face a team sitting immediately behind them on the standings and coming off a draw against Mamelodi Sundowns.
Since the start of the current season, Royal AM have notched a single victory, but have suffered only one loss and played to three draws.
Three points for either team would put them within striking distance of table-topping Cape Town City, with both teams needing consistent early-season performances to mount a genuine title challenge.
Head-to-Head
This will be only the third time these two teams have met at their level, with the Buccaneers holding a perfect record in this fledgling rivalry.
In their first meeting, Mpumelelo Ndaba’s first-half goal was the deciding factor, but in their most recent meeting, the Soweto Giants prevailed by a larger margin, 3-1, thanks to goals from Boitumelo Radiopane and Nkosinathi Temba.
